Description:

The emperor's [Joseph I] minister with Marlborough's army to the emperor (copy): he has received Joseph's letter about winter quarters for his troops in Italy and reported his wishes to Marlborough, assuring him that the troops would be employed in the coming year on the upper Rhine and in Brabant. Marlborough wished them to depart from Italy in December. Comparisons with the conditions of the troops of the landgrave of Hesse and King Augustus [of Poland]. If the emperor [Joseph I] were to withdraw his troops, the Dutch and Prince Eugene would have the pretext for making a separate peace. ff.191,192

Date: 1708 Sep 01-1708 Oct 31
